Reinforcing One Forearm Bone Before A Break

Washington, DC rates for HCPCS 25491

Strengthens a single bone of the forearm before it breaks, using a rod, plate, pins, or wires, sometimes with bone cement to fill a weakened cavity. It is done when the bone has been weakened by a tumor or another disease and is likely to fracture under ordinary use. Only one of the two forearm bones is treated, rather than both.
